Legendary Texas band the Toadies will be performing 5 reunion concerts across the state with stops in Austin, Houston, San Antonio, Corpus Christi and Grand Prairie in December as well as 3 additional just announced dates in Louisiana and Arkansas.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
After releasing their debut album, &lt;i&gt;Rubberneck&lt;/i&gt; 1994 on Interscope, to both wide critical acclaim and commercial success, achieving Platinum status in 1995, issues with their record company delayed the release of the second disc, &lt;i&gt;Hell Below / Stars Above&lt;/i&gt;, until 2001 and 5 months later the band broke up, leaving fans worldwide wanting more.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
After 2 reunion shows in 2006, the reformed band played several Texas dates in the spring of 2007, including 2 sold out nights at Stubb&#039;s BarBQ in Austin right before the start of it&#039;s annual SXSW festival. We got a chance to speak with Vaden Todd Lewis, the distinctive voice that helps set the Toadies apart from any other band. If the music you hear behind the Burden Brothers new single sounds familiar, it probably should. Former Toadies (I Come From The Water, Possum Kingdom) frontman Vaden Todd Lewis has teamed up with &quot;Taz&quot; Bentley (Reverend Horton Heat, Tenderloin, Izzy Stradlin Band), Corey Rozzoni (Clumsy)Casey Hess (Doosu, Jump Rope Girls) and bassist Zack Busby (Slow Roosevelt, Halls of the Machine) to form what their &lt;a href=&quot;http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Burden_Brothers&quot;  title=&quot;http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Burden_Brothers&quot;&gt;Wikipedia entry&lt;/a&gt; calls a Texas Rock Supergroup. That is probably an apt description as Vaden&#039;s characteristic vocals are unmistakable to any Toadies fan that hears them and Taz and the rest of the band have spent countless hours performing on the road.&lt;br /&gt;

SXSW&#039;s genre descriptions aside, Kinksi started as a drone band in Seattle and over the years have emerged with a much more complex sound, combining heavy crashing guitars and percussion into a psychedelic rock soufflÃ©. This is one of those sink back into your comfy chair, put the headphones on and listen to the ride experiences.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Spending time touring in the U.S., Japan, and Europe with bands like Mission of Burma, Oneida, Comets on Fire, and Acid Mothers Temple, their last release was in 2005 on the Sub Pop label, the label responsible of breaking Nirvana and the Seattle grunge scene. Making a special trip to Austin just for SXSW I had a chance to speak with Chris Martin about their upcoming gig, touring, and the Seattle music scene. Discovered playing on the streets by songwriter Jack Lee, Peter Case went on, along with Lee and Paul Collins to form the seminal power-pop band The Nerves. Later when the Nerves broke up Collins went on to form The Beat and Peter Case went on, along with Austinite &quot;Fast&quot; Eddie Munoz, to form the power pop band The Plimsouls. Case and The Plimsouls gained fame penning the song &quot;Million Miles Away&quot; and performing in the film &quot;Valley Girl&quot; before dissolving, though they still get together every once in a while.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Peter Case still performs as a solo artist, and not pigeonholed in one genre or another slides effortlessly back and forth between bittersweet power pop ballads, classic Americana, and southern blues. I was introduced to the music of Hugh Cornwell and the Stranglers by none other than Joey Ramone himself, backstage at a Ramones gig at the Armadillo. It was one of the bands they started listening too after their early trips to the UK, and he thought I would really like them.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
In the days before MTV, the internet, Amazon.com, and MySpace, a few small magazines with limited distribution and word of mouth were the only ways to get buzz, and it passed slowly as a small number of bands toured the tiny punk club circuit of the late 70s and early 80s. The crowds they reached were all rather small, but all the old school bands that survived started that way. Bands like U2, the Police, even the Red Hot Chili Peppers did their first tours on this circuit and the interest in what is now known as &quot;alternative&quot; music was slowly spread this way. Mainstream music was embracing songs from Barry Manilow and the Bee Gees, and god help us, the song &quot;Muskrat Love&quot; was still being heard on FM radio. &quot;Freebird&quot; and &quot;Stairway&quot; were in constant rotation on all the album oriented rock stations, and anything that even remotely smelled of punk was limited to the middle of the night on a few college radio stations.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The Stranglers made their run down that circuit as well, but only briefly. By the time the Stranglers hit Austin, I was already a huge fan, owning all their released vinyl up to that point, most of it as UK imports.  Their only Austin appearance was at brand new punk club called Club Foot. Formerly the 404 Club, one of Austin&#039;s first gay hotspots, Club Foot&#039;s opening night had the Stranglers as headliners. But the show was poorly publicized, the club was unknown, and nobody seemed to have told the former patrons of the change in the club&#039;s business model, making me glad I had left my studded leather Ramones jacket at home.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
I looked back on that night as one of my best memories of the old scene days. The audience, though few in number, was comprised mainly of Austin&#039;s music hipsters and members of local bands, along with a small number of friends I had talked into going. We had a blast as they roiled through songs like &quot;Tank&quot; and &quot;Peaches.&quot; JJ Burnell&#039;s body flailed wildly as he provided the driving bassline behind Hugh Cornwell&#039;s throaty growl.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Hugh Cornwell, former lead singer of the Stranglers, will be a performer at Austin&#039;s SXSW this year and it gives me an opportunity to dust off all my old memories from those days. Back in 1980, when both Paul Collins and I had a lot more hair and Austin was just becoming the hotbed of the alternative music scene that it is today, some interesting tours came to town. One of these included a gig by Paul Weller&#039;s UK band the Jam, at the old Armadillo World Headquarters. Opening that gig was a band called the Beat that I expected to be the ska band of the same name, also from the U.K.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Instead it turned out to Paul Collins&#039; Beat, or the L.A. Beat, a slick, buzzy powerpop foursome whose sound showed a variety of influences. Lead by Paul Collins, who along with Peter Case was one of the founding members of the Nerves, the Beat bounded from Beatlesesque harmonies, to almost a pure Ramones rip, to Stray Cats -nfluenced guitar twang, each song seemingly hookier than the next. The influences came honestly, with Paul and the Nerves touring with the Ramones in 74, and the Nerves even penning the song &quot;Hanging on The Telephone&quot;  later made a hit by  their friends in Blondie.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
After a 10 year hiatus from the music scene, Paul Collins will return with the Beat to Austin&#039;s SXSW festival with an official SXSW gig as well as several other local sets. We were lucky enough to  get a chance to talk to him about his SXSW gig and what is was like back in the day before there was an &quot;alternative&quot; or &quot;indie&quot; music scene.     &lt;img width=&#039;200&#039; style=&quot;float: right; border: 0px; padding-left: 5px; padding-right: 5px;&quot; src=&quot;http://club.kingsnake.com/uploads/200px-XTC_Drums_and_Wires.jpg&quot; alt=&quot;&quot; /&gt;When I started out as a music journalist in 1980, the second band I interviewed was one that had come all the way from the U.K. on their very first tour to play Austin&#039;s legendary Armadillo World Headquarters. They were supporting their first album release, &lt;i&gt;Drums and Wires&lt;/i&gt;, and I was very fortunate to see them because shortly afterward they stopped touring completely.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
With classic songs such as &quot;Making Plans For Nigel&quot; and &quot;Life Begins at the Hop,&quot;  a slew of other singles like &quot;Senses Working Overtime,&quot;&quot;Sgt. Rock (Is Going to Help Me),&quot; and &quot;Generals and Majors,&quot; as well as the incredible and controversial &quot;Dear God,&quot; XTC has influenced countless bands over the years with their complex arrangements, poetic lyrics and intricate sound. They remain a favorite among musicians and fans worldwide. Their music has been covered by artists ranging in diversity from Primus to Sarah McLachlan, and they have worked with musicians such as Peter Gabriel, Aimee Mann, Thomas Dolby, the band Blur, and others.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
I was fortunate to have an opportunity to speak with Andy Partridge from his studio in the U.K. and to catch up a little bit on the 30+ years since our last conversation.
